Donald J Trump is correct that there is crime and bedlam in DC, but it’s mostly coming from his White House over my shoulder, not the folks out here on the streets.
I’ve worked on a number of events in many areas of DC over the past 20 years with a lot of local crew people and folks coming in from around the nation. I’ve never personally felt threatened anywhere or any time. If anything the level of security was pretty obvious and comforting. Thousands of people would not be traveling to DC and participating in these events if they felt unsafe.
If you set up a camera tripod in the wrong place without a permit or linger with your vehicle too long you usually get swarmed by Park or DC Police.
The other thing you witness, especially in the Mall area around the monuments and museums are lots of school groups and tourists on buses and walking….peacefully.
I have witnessed some homeless people and been approached by some for a little support.
One cold evening I took a homeless pregnant woman into a Burger King and bought her a meal. Another time I saw 2 fellows on some steps in the Chinatown area and they had a cardboard sign that said “we won’t lie to you, we just want to get high”. I thanked them for their honest approach but declined to contribute to their quest. They laughed and thanked me for talking with them.
This deployment of National Guard troops along with FBI and others is REALLY disturbing me and my local crew friends. We see and feel no need for it now. On Jan 6 it was needed. It’s the only time any of our friends have been attacked and their video equipment destroyed.
Trump could have used his power then….but sadly declined to do the right thing.
